  • Since a lot of you guys asked, here's part 3 of the squares. In this video we cover historical models starting from the very first G-Shock ever made, the DW-5000C, moving to the Wide Temp models the WW-5100 and WW-5300. The DW-5400 and DW-5500 are also mentioned before we move to the HERO that saved the GShock line from cancelation, the DW-5200. The classic DW-5600C is where we move next and also cover the DW-500C, which is the origin of the Baby-G line. After that we move to the weird and oversized models, like the DW-5300 and DW-6800, as well as the "game" models DW-8000 and DW-8100 before we end this part with the "Stargate" model DW-8300.     Great evolutionary video, thank you. I've got the DW-8300 which I've been giving a good old servicing over the last few days, now it's really sparkly. My son is amazing miniature model painter and kindly refreshed the G-Shock and Illuminator logos perfectly to match with the original colours. My only design gripes are that the buttons are very recessed which I think could have been better being far more prominent and would still be equally aesthetically pleasing. I also wish the backlight would stay on for double the length of time it does, especially important if you need to use other features such as the stop watch at night. For servicing and maintenance, everything comes apart with 16 x cross-head screws and you can easily clean every part of the inner and outer casing, wings and straps. The battery is a nice big CR2016. Overall, it's a very tough and not-so-little vintage timekeeping beast!
